Weather News: IMD Orange Warning for Punjab, Up, Assam and 8 States

Weather updates: The Indian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ued an Orange warning to 11 states, including Assam and Punjab. This warning refers to the possibility of bad weather conditions in these areas. IMD has expressed the possibility of rain in states like Rajasthan, Punjab, Haryana, Uttar Pradesh, Madhya Pradesh, Assam,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Tripura, Manipur and Nagaland. Madhya Pradesh also will rain
Similarly, in Madhya Pradesh, Maharashtra, Chhattisga H, Bihar, West Bengal and Jharkhand, there is a possibility of moderate rain, thunder and strong winds on June 3 and 4. Residents of these areas are advised to be cautious in the adverse conditions of the weather.
